⚡ Hybrid Engine Performance & World-Class Fuel Efficiency

At the core of the Toyota Aqua 2026 is Toyota’s renowned Hybrid Synergy Drive system, paired with a highly efficient 1.5-liter Dynamic Force 3-cylinder petrol engine and an electric motor.

Mechanical Specifications:

  • Engine Type: 1.5L Dynamic Force Inline 3-Cylinder Petrol Engine

  • Electric Motor: High-output Permanent Magnet Synchronous Motor

  • Total System Power: Approximately 114 Horsepower (Combined)

  • Transmission: Electronically controlled Continuously Variable Transmission (e-CVT)

  • Drivetrain Options: Front-Wheel Drive (FWD) and E-Four (Electronic All-Wheel Drive System)

Unmatched Fuel Mileage:

The primary selling point of the Aqua 2026 remains its extreme fuel economy. Under standard test conditions, the hatchback achieves an extraordinary 33 to 35 km/L (kilometers per liter). The vehicle intelligently switches between pure Electric Vehicle (EV) mode at low speeds and hybrid mode during acceleration, conserving every drop of fuel.

🛡️ Advanced Safety Suite: Toyota Safety Sense 3.0

Safety remains a top priority across all Toyota models. The 2026 Aqua comes standard with the full Toyota Safety Sense 3.0 active safety package.

  • Pre-Collision System with Pedestrian Detection: Scans the road ahead using radar and camera sensors to automatically brake if a collision is imminent.

  • Dynamic Radar Cruise Control (Full-Speed Range): Maintains a preset distance from the car ahead, automatically decelerating and accelerating in traffic jams.

  • Lane Tracing Assist (LTA) and Lane Departure Alert: Provides subtle steering adjustments to keep the vehicle safely centered in its lane.

  • Park Support Brake: Uses sonar sensors to detect stationary objects or oncoming vehicles when reversing out of parking spots.

💰 Ownership, Maintenance, and Resale Expectations

Owning a Toyota Aqua 2026 comes with low long-term operational costs. Thanks to the regenerative braking system, brake pads experience less wear and tear compared to traditional internal combustion vehicles. Additionally, Toyota’s widespread service network ensures that replacement parts, hybrid battery servicing, and routine maintenance are affordable and accessible globally. Furthermore, the Aqua brand consistently retains high resale value in second-hand automotive markets.

❓ Frequently Asked Questions (FAQs)

1. What is the real-world fuel consumption of the Toyota Aqua 2026?

In standard city and highway driving conditions, owners can expect a real-world fuel economy averaging around 30 to 35 km/L, depending on driving habits and terrain.

2. Does the Toyota Aqua 2026 offer All-Wheel Drive (AWD)?

Yes, Toyota offers the Aqua 2026 with an optional E-Four electronic all-wheel-drive system, which uses a dedicated electric motor to power the rear wheels when extra traction is needed on slippery roads.

3. How long does the hybrid battery last in the Toyota Aqua?

Toyota's nickel-metal hydride and lithium-ion hybrid batteries are engineered to last the lifespan of the vehicle, typically surviving 8 to 10 years or well over 150,000 to 200,000 kilometers with proper cooling system maintenance.
